There many projects that I found on Pinterest that I just plain didn't know how to do. For example, I was trying to collaborate with the 4th & 5th grade teachers on geometry. The best project i found was origami, but unfortunately I had no resources on how to do origami. Thankfully there are Youtube tutorials that I can learn from. I took it one step further and had my students in groups look up their own tutorials on origami. The lesson was a hit with the joy factor all over it! |
